Environment: Urban Accessibility with Design Limitations

The Hampton Inn Boston/Cambridge is situated on Monsignor O'Brien Highway (Route 28), placing it in a busy urban corridor. While not directly nestled within the historic charm of Harvard or MIT campuses, its location offers significant advantages for accessibility. It's less than two miles from both Harvard and MIT, making it a viable option for those visiting these prestigious institutions. A key environmental benefit is its direct proximity to the Lechmere T (subway) station, which is located just across the street. This provides quick and easy access to downtown Boston, the TD Garden for sports and concerts, and other key areas of the city, making it an excellent base for car-free exploration.

The hotel, built in 2002 and reportedly renovated in February 2021, features 114 rooms spread across seven floors. While the rooms are generally described as clean and modern, some reviews note them as being "small." The aesthetic is typically what one would expect from a Hampton Inn – functional, contemporary, and designed for comfort rather than lavishness. Common areas are likely well-maintained, but the overall atmosphere might feel more like a transit-oriented hotel rather than a resort, given its highway-side location. The fitness center is specifically mentioned as being "quite small," almost like a "fitness closet," which could be a drawback for guests accustomed to more expansive workout facilities.

Services: Standard Offerings with Inconsistent Hospitality

As a Hampton Inn, the hotel generally adheres to the brand's commitment to offering specific services to enhance guest stays. These typically include:

  • Complimentary Breakfast: A free hot buffet breakfast is a staple of Hampton Inn, and this location offers it daily (6:00 AM to 9:00 AM on weekdays, 7:00 AM to 10:00 AM on weekends). While it provides a convenient and cost-saving start to the day, one guest noted that the "breakfast food was as expected for a free buffet. Not so good," suggesting a standard, rather than exceptional, quality.
  • Free Wi-Fi: High-speed wireless internet access is available throughout the hotel, both in rooms and public areas, catering to the needs of business and leisure travelers alike.
  • Fitness Center: Despite its small size, the fitness center is equipped with treadmills, an elliptical, dumbbells, and even a Peloton bike, offering basic workout options for guests.
  • Parking: A significant advantage, especially in the Boston/Cambridge area, is the complimentary covered self-parking. However, parking is limited to one space per unit and has height restrictions (6'8" max), with additional paid parking available nearby if the on-site lot is full.
  • Pet-Friendly Policy: The hotel is pet-friendly, allowing up to two pets with a maximum combined weight of 75 lbs (dogs or cats only), for a non-refundable fee ($75 for 1-4 nights, $125 for 5+ nights).
  • 24-Hour Front Desk: A 24-hour front desk is available for guest assistance, luggage storage, and express check-out.
  • Other Amenities: Other standard services include a business center, laundry service/dry cleaning, and coin-operated laundry facilities, a vending machine, and coffee/tea in common areas. Housekeeping is offered on request (every other day or every two days as per one review).

Features: Location-Centric Benefits and Room Basics

The core features of the Hampton Inn Boston/Cambridge primarily revolve around its convenient location and standard in-room amenities:

  • Unbeatable Location for Transit: The hotel's proximity to the Lechmere T station is a major feature, offering direct and quick subway access to Boston's major attractions, including downtown, TD Garden, Museum of Science, and Fenway Park. This makes it ideal for sports fans, concert-goers, and tourists who prefer public transportation over driving in the city.
  • Proximity to Academic Hubs: Its closeness to MIT and Harvard makes it a practical choice for visiting prospective students, faculty, or those attending events at these universities.
  • Room Comforts: Guest rooms, though noted as small by some, are equipped with comforts such as down comforters, comfortable mattresses, laptop-compatible safes, desks and desk chairs, flat-screen HDTVs (49-inch) with premium channels and first-run movies, coffee/tea makers, irons/ironing boards, and blackout drapes. Bathrooms include designer toiletries, hair dryers, and private facilities. Climate-controlled air conditioning and heating are standard.
  • Accessibility: The hotel offers ADA accessible rooms with features like accessible tubs or roll-in showers, and the property has various accessibility features like braille signage, elevators with wide doors, and wheelchair-accessible paths of travel.
  • Pet-Friendly: As mentioned, the ability to bring pets is a valuable feature for many travelers.

While the hotel was renovated in 2021, the emphasis appears to be on standardizing comfort and providing functional amenities rather than luxurious ones, which aligns with the Hampton Inn brand. The "small" nature of the fitness center and the reported size of some rooms indicate a focus on efficiency in an urban environment.

Great location, Lechmere T train station is right outside the hotel, which also serves as a hub for several bus lines. However, if you’re a super light sleeper, you might be bothered by this because you might feel or hear the trains go by. It became white noise for me and didn’t affect my quality of sleep at all even though I consider myself a light sleeper. The underground garage parking is free and is accessed via hotel keycard. The spots are very close together though, so maneuvering in the garage with a larger vehicle will need patience. Like others have said, parking will likely be challenging to find in the garage if it’s a popular weekend or peak travel season. There is no EV charging in the garage but there are 4 public chargers on streets nearby (2 on water street and 2 on Morgan for $0.24/ kWh). These street parking spots are free but limited to 2 hours from 8AM-8PM, so you can charge overnight if you find a spot. I’m currently here in the middle of January and parking was easy to find on Thursday, more challenging on Friday but still a handful of empty spots, and Saturday night was the busiest but still didn’t have a scenario where I didn’t find a spot upon arriving at the garage. In total there are probably around 30 parking spots. Breakfast is ok, standard Hampton inn fare of bananas, apples, oatmeal, waffle stations, orange juice, drip coffee, scrambled eggs, sausage, etc The gym is very small here but has 1 peloton bike, 2 treadmills, and free weights up to 50. Hotel is dog friendly and the rate is 75 per stay up to 4 nights with additional charges for additional nights or dogs
